April in Trimbak, India, showcases a climate characterized by warm temperatures and low humidity. The maximum temperature soars to 42°C (107°F), while the average settles at a pleasant 29°C (85°F) and dips to a minimum of 19°C (67°F) at night. Humidity levels hover around 38%, offering a relatively dry heat. Notably, the month records no precipitation, with only 3 mm (0.1 in) recorded, ensuring clear skies and plenty of sunshine for outdoor activities.

In April, Trimbak, India experiences a slight uptick in humidity, measured at 38% — a modest increase compared to the preceding months. This marks a transition from the drier conditions of January through March, which saw humidity levels drop to a low of 37% in March. As the region heads into the monsoon months, humidity begins its significant rise, jumping to 53% in May and soaring dramatically to 89% by July. This underscores a clear trend: after the relatively dry early months of the year, Trimbak prepares for the arrival of the monsoon with a gradual increase in humidity that culminates in the peak rainy season, revealing the climatic shift characteristic of this tropical region.
In April, the UV Index in Trimbak, India, reaches an impressive 12, categorizing the exposure as extreme with a burn time of just 10 minutes. This marks a continued upward trend from March, when the index hit 11, signaling that the sun's intensity is increasing as the month progresses. As we move deeper into the year, the UV Index remains consistently high, peaking at 13 in May and 14 in July and August, reinforcing the necessity for sun protection. In Trimbak, India, the evolving patterns of daylight throughout the year reveal an engaging rhythm of nature. As winter gives way to spring, January and February provide a consistent 11 hours of daylight. With the arrival of March, daylight hours start to stretch, reaching 12 hours—a theme that continues into April. This trend of gradually increasing daylight peaks in May and June, where residents enjoy a generous 13 hours of sunlight. As summer presents its full glory, the daylight remains steady before gently tapering off in the subsequent months. By August, the days begin to shorten again, settling back to 11 hours by the close of the year.
